On the contrary. My point is that "Republican" does not mean "conservative." I keep hearing that "we" are winning because Republicans have been elected. But the elected Republicans support the same liberal programs that the Democrats were pushing. They are not conservative.
So, when people tell me that the constitutional convention will be under the control of conservatives, and they support this by showing how many state legislatures are dominated by Republicans, I have to laugh. Liberals run the show. Some are called Democrats, some are called Republicans.
Let's not put the Constitution on the table for open heart surgery until we know who the surgeon is going to be. Laws can be repealed. If conservatives ever do get the upper hand, laws can be undone. If we allow the liberals to mess up the Constitution, it will be much harder to undo that.
